Ochilo Ayacko. Ochilo Ayacko. Ochilo George Mbogo Ayacko (born 1968) [1] is a Kenyan politician who has served as the governor of Migori County since August 2022. [2] He previously represented Migori County in the Senate of Kenya, beginning with the October 2018 by-election [3] to replace Senator Ben Oluoch, who died in June 2018. [4]

The Daily Monitor is a Ugandan independent daily newspaper. Its name is shared by the Saturday Monitor and Sunday Monitor, which are also published by Monitor Publications Limited. [3] Daily Monitor averaged a daily circulation of 24,230 newspapers in September 2011. [4] By the fourth quarter of 2019, that figure had dropped to 16,169 copies daily.

Business Daily Africa, commonly known as Business Daily, is an English-language daily business newspaper published in Kenya. The newspaper is published by Nation Media Group from its headquarters at Nation Centre on Kimathi Street in Nairobi, Kenya. [1]
